标题:帮我看看这程序哪里错了
只看楼主
lgf_520
Rank: 1
等 级:新手上路
帖 子:1
专家分:0
注 册:2005-9-28
 问题点数:0 回复次数:2 
帮我看看这程序哪里错了
<form name="form1"  >
  <input name="text1" type="text" id="text1" size="10">
  <input type="submit" name="Submit" onClick="num()" >
</form>
<script language="javascript">
 function num()
 {    var flag1=false;
      var compStr="4567839012";
      var a=from1.text1.value;
      var length2=a.length;
      for (var iIndex=0;iIndex<length2;iIndex++)
   {    var temp1=compStr.indexOf(a.charAt(iIndex));
  if(temp1==-1)
  { flag1=false;
   alert("不对") ;
   break;      
  } else
  {flag1=true;} } return flag1; }
</script>
搜索更多相关主题的帖子: javascript function false 
2005-09-28 19:21
rainic
Rank: 6Rank: 6
等 级:贵宾
威 望:27
帖 子:2367
专家分:0
注 册:2005-8-9
得分:0 
var temp1 应该定义在FOR循环外面

2005-09-30 08:07
tody
Rank: 1
等 级:新手上路
威 望:2
帖 子:119
专家分:0
注 册:2005-11-17
得分:0 
你写的东东真行了!!根本句没什么用
[CODE]
<form name="form1" >
<input name="text1" type="text" id="text1" size="10">
<input type="submit" name="Submit" onClick="num()" >
</form>
<script language="javascript">
function num()
{
var flag1=false;
var compStr="4567839012";
var a=form1.text1.value;
var length2=a.length;
for (var iIndex=0;iIndex<length2;iIndex++)
{
var temp1=compStr.indexOf(a.charAt(iIndex));
if(temp1==-1)
{
flag1=false;
alert("不对") ;
break;
}
else
{
flag1=true;
}
}
return flag1;
}
</script>
[/CODE]

记录就是用来破的, 自尊就是用来伤的。
2005-11-18 10:26



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-28945-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.234073 second(s), 10 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ved